Cut through the noise and learn how to make clear, confident decisions—even when every project, feature, or request feels urgent. Join us for a thoughtful, energizing roundtable built for PMs, designers, founders, and anyone navigating complex prioritization.

This month, we’re tackling one of the hardest parts of product work: prioritization when everything seems important.

We’ll dig into practical frameworks, real-world stories, and the subtle judgment calls that separate reactive product teams from intentional, high-impact ones. Expect an evening of good people, good conversation, and plenty of honest examples of what works—and what absolutely doesn’t. (Plus pizza!)

Whether you’re stewarding a roadmap at work, shipping your own product, or juggling side projects, you’ll walk away with:

  • Ways to distinguish urgency from importance when the stakes feel high
  • Tools for evaluating tradeoffs across competing goals
  • Approaches for saying “not now” without burning bridges
  • Stories from other builders about hard prioritization moments—and how they navigated them

Join us for our monthly in-person roundtable session of The Product Group Hudson Valley, a local chapter of the world’s largest and longest-running product management communities.

  • Who should attend: Product managers, aspiring PMs, product designers, entrepreneurs, and anyone interested in understanding the role of product management -- whether you’re just starting out or already leading teams.
  • Takeaway: Learn practical techniques for focusing your team, clarifying value, and driving momentum.
  • Format: Interactive roundtable discussion, where everyone will share experiences, explore challenges, and exchange ideas.

Tom di Mino is a poet-turned AI Content Engineer whose career spans creative writing, UX, and large-scale LLM systems. He has held senior contract roles at Google, JPMorganChase, and the Chan Zuckerberg Initiative, and is currently Principal AI/ML Engineer at Aldea, where he builds voice-first AI advisors using advanced STT/TTS pipelines and post-Transformer LLM architectures.
